Sintra Marmoris Camelia Hotel
38.79914, -9.38709Sintra Marmoris Camelia Hotel is 20 km away from Aerodromo Municipal de Cascais airport and provides airport shuttle services and car rentals. Located at a 650-metre distance from the 11th century Moorish Sintra National Palace as well as the known Park Liberdade, the recently renovated guest house includes windsurfing, diving, and horseback riding.

Sintra Marmoris Camelia Hotel features 9 rooms with a flat-screen TV with satellite channels, as well as a mini-fridge-bar and coffee/tea making equipment. Furnished with a work desk, they also have soundproof windows. For more comfort, hairdryers and complimentary toiletries, along with a roll-in shower and a tub, are provided. You can enjoy views of the mountain.
